OpenAI proposes new evaluation standards to reduce false answers

OpenAI’s latest research explains why large language models generate false answers: current training regimes reward correct guesses but give zero credit when the model admits uncertainty. This incentive structure hardwires systems to “always answer,” even when they don’t know, leading to confident but wrong outputs. In controlled tests like asking for specific birthdays or dissertation titles models consistently produced different, equally confident mistakes. The paper proposes a redesign of evaluation metrics that penalize confident errors more than honest uncertainty. This shift could redefine AI reliability, prioritizing truthfulness over benchmark scores and opening a path toward models that know when not to answer.

Potential Impact

This research directly affects high-stakes domains where hallucinations are unacceptable: healthcare diagnostics, financial forecasting, and legal or compliance work. Systems that can reliably decline to answer when unsure will gain trust in regulated industries. Developers building copilots, enterprise search, and research assistants could integrate “uncertainty-aware” responses, reducing liability while boosting adoption. For enterprises, this means more dependable automation and fewer costly errors in workflows where misinformation carries real financial or reputational risk.

OpenAI is launching a jobs platform to connect businesses with AI-skilled workers, paired with a certification program inside ChatGPT to validate AI fluency. Partnering with Walmart and other employers, OpenAI will offer tiered certifications that measure practical AI literacy, with a stated goal of certifying 10 million Americans by 2030. The move builds on the OpenAI Academy and coincides with White House initiatives on AI literacy and workforce development. By combining training and placement, OpenAI is positioning itself not just as a toolmaker but as a labor-market infrastructure player. This directly challenges LinkedIn’s dominance in talent matching while addressing the looming skills gap for businesses and governments adopting AI. If successful, it accelerates both AI adoption in the workplace and the retraining of displaced workers, making AI literacy a baseline skill for employment rather than a niche advantage.

DeepSeek, the Hangzhou based startup, is developing an AI agent with multi step capabilities and autonomous learning, targeting release in late 2025. The agent is designed to go beyond simple Q&A and act on behalf of users by carrying out workflows, improving through feedback, and executing tasks with minimal direction. Earlier this year, DeepSeek’s R1 platform outperformed benchmarks while being cost efficient, and the company now aims to extend that edge into agents that can function more like digital workers than chatbots. This move aligns with the global shift from static large language models to autonomous agents capable of handling complex, multi step processes. If successful, DeepSeek will force a reset in user expectations, raising the bar for what people demand from AI systems while positioning itself as a serious challenger to OpenAI and Anthropic.

AlterEgo (Boston) introduced a wearable interface that decodes neuromuscular signals from the jaw and throat when you internally “speak” words (without vocalizing) and turns them into text or device commands. It uses machine-learning models trained on subtler facial/throat muscle activations, plus bone-conduction audio to give users private feedback. The tech builds on research from MIT’s Media Lab (2018 prototype) with the goal of making a non-invasive alternative to brain implants or bulky EMG hardware. The company hasn’t shared pricing or full launch dates, but plans to show it publicly at the Axios AI+ Summit in mid-September 2025. Potential applications include silent control in noisy environments, private commands, and restoring speech ability in people who can’t speak.
